In When Listening Comes Alive, Paul Madaule re-awakens a skill that we all have - a skill that can improve communication, creativity and learning, allowing a fuller and more energetic life. Paul demystifies Listening Training as both clinician and client. Diagnosed as dyslexic at an early age, he experienced a remarkable recovery with the help of Dr Alfred Tomatis. Since then, at The Listening Centre in Toronto, Paul has helped thousands of people for over 35 years. He has summarized listening training and has included a unique selection of "Earobics", daily exercises to develop and improve your listening skills. This is a book about listening through life - for parents-to-be, hard working professionals, teachers, early childhood educators and parents seeking help for children with learning disabilities, ADHD or in the autistic spectrum. When Listening Comes Alive is a guide to a better and more fulfilling way of living.

Born in France, Paul Madaule studied at the University of Paris-Sorbonne while training with Dr. Alfred Tomatis and graduated in psychology in 1972. After years of practicing and teaching the Tomatis Listening Training work in Europe and South Africa, Paul came to Toronto Canada in 1978 to start The Listening Centre.

Paul was involved in setting up centres in the US and Mexico and he created Listening Fitness with the  LiFT®, a portable audio-device and professional training course that provides the listening work to wider audiences.

Paul is also the author of numerous articles on subjects related to the educational and therapeutic value of music, voice and Listening Training with children with developmental and learning problems. He also co-authored About the Tomatis Method. The book When Listening Comes Alive, first published in 1993, is translated in ten Languages.

Paul is currently a director of The Listening Centre in Toronto.
